#4923b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4923b4 is composed of 28.6% red, 13.7%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.4%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 42.2%. #4923b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9246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4923b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4923b4 has RGB values of R:73, G:35,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4793268.

Shades and Tints of #4923b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060310 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4923b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686572 is the less saturated color, while #3902d5 is the most saturated one.
